Financial Performance - The company reported a basic earnings per share of -0.27 yuan for the first half of 2021, an improvement from -1.11 yuan in the same period last year[20]. - The diluted earnings per share also stood at -0.27 yuan, consistent with the basic earnings per share[20]. - The weighted average return on net assets increased by 5.35 percentage points to -7.99% compared to -13.34% in the previous year[20]. - The net profit attributable to shareholders was a loss of ¥157,925,006.92, improving from a loss of ¥539,082,537.57 in the previous year[22]. - The net profit for the first half of 2021 was CNY -161,331,735.18, an improvement from CNY -548,563,617.00 in the same period last year, indicating a recovery in operations[130]. - The company reported a net loss of ¥183,846,709.77 for the first half of 2021, an improvement from a net loss of ¥591,217,268.73 in the first half of 2020[142]. - The company reported a significant increase in cash received from sales of goods and services, totaling RMB 727,932.55 million in the first half of 2021, compared to RMB 532,466.17 million in the same period of 2020[149]. Revenue and Costs - The company's operating revenue for the first half of the year reached ¥784,930,275.49, a significant increase of 136.19% compared to ¥332,335,025.55 in the same period last year[22]. - Operating costs increased to CNY 537,800,873, up 50.58% compared to the previous year[46]. - Total operating revenue for the first half of 2021 reached ¥784,930,275.49, a significant increase of 135.5% compared to ¥332,335,025.55 in the same period of 2020[141]. - Total operating costs amounted to ¥913,449,332.10, up 29.3% from ¥706,502,247.56 year-on-year[141]. Assets and Liabilities - The total assets decreased by 4.92% to ¥8,550,494,830.06 from ¥8,993,156,438.67 at the end of the previous year[22]. - The total liabilities increased to ¥6,395,307,583.31, up from ¥6,048,069,247.15 at the end of the previous period[138]. - The total equity decreased to ¥2,361,105,779.64 from ¥2,542,529,741.12, reflecting a decline of 7.1%[138]. - The company's total assets amounted to ¥8,756,413,362.95, an increase from ¥8,590,598,988.27 in the previous period[138]. - The total equity attributable to shareholders decreased to RMB 1,898,536,676.39 from RMB 2,112,520,063.28, a decline of 10.1%[135]. Cash Flow - The net cash flow from operating activities was ¥306,983,081.45, representing a 29.64% increase from ¥236,789,762.62 in the same period last year[22]. - Cash flow from operating activities generated RMB 306,983.08 million in the first half of 2021, an increase from RMB 236,789.76 million in the first half of 2020[149]. - The net cash flow from investing activities decreased primarily due to payments for copyright purchases and share buybacks[52]. - The cash interest coverage ratio significantly improved to 3.31, a 241.24% increase from 0.97 in the previous year, reflecting stronger cash flow management[130]. Strategic Focus - The company is focused on the dual business strategy of "film and television + sports," aiming to enhance synergy and explore monetization opportunities post-pandemic[30]. - The company aims to leverage its resources and market communication to accelerate performance recovery and growth in the post-pandemic environment[30]. - The company has established long-term partnerships with over ten national Olympic committees and numerous well-known sports stars, enhancing its international sports resource advantage[39]. - The company is actively involved in sports marketing, facilitating partnerships with major brands such as Konami and China Mobile for AFC events[34]. Risks and Challenges - The company has outlined potential risks in its management discussion and analysis section, urging investors to be cautious[6]. - The company faces risks related to potential adverse changes in operating policies, particularly in the film and sports industries due to regulatory scrutiny[69]. - The company faces risks from intensified market competition, which may lead to increased costs and declining sales prices and revenues, particularly in the sports industry[70]. - The ongoing impact of the COVID-19 pandemic may affect the company's operations, particularly if international sports events are canceled or postponed[79]. Shareholder Information - As of the end of the reporting period, the total number of ordinary shareholders is 24,696[109]. - The company has completed the acquisition of control from the previous major shareholders, with Guochuang Capital now holding 27.39% of the voting rights[108]. - The top ten shareholders hold a total of 80,262,230 shares, representing 13.73% of the total shares outstanding[111]. - The largest individual shareholder, Jiang Lizhang, has 46,903,568 shares, which is 8.02% of the total shares, with 5,260,000 shares pledged[111]. Corporate Governance - The company has committed to ensuring its independence and avoiding competition with its listed subsidiaries since May 18, 2015, but has not fully complied with this commitment[92]. - The company has made a commitment to avoid any form of competition with its listed company and to reduce and standardize related party transactions since July 13, 2021, and has complied with this commitment[92]. - The company has not engaged in any related party transactions with Guochuang Capital in the past 12 months, aside from the current private placement[99].
